For reasons still unknown, xe appears to require a stride alignment of
XE_PAGE_SIZE, and using 64 leads to sporadic failures. Go back to having
separate stride alignment for i915 and xe, until the issue is root
caused.

The display part of Wa_22019338487 (i.e., avoiding use of stolen memory)
is using a platform test rather than an graphics/media IP test.  Since
this workaround is focused on non-GT uses of stolen memory, it makes
sense that we'd want to still apply the workaround on affected platforms
even if the GTs themselves are disabled via configfs.
